WebDriverException怎么解决
时间: 2023-11-13 07:14:37 浏览: 50
解决WebDriverException的方法取决于具体的异常情况,以下是一些可能的解决方法:
1. 检查浏览器版本:如果您使用的是WebDriver驱动程序和浏览器版本不兼容,那么可能会导致WebDriverException。请确保WebDriver驱动程序和浏览器版本相匹配。
2. 检查元素定位:如果您的测试代码中包含了找不到的元素的定位器,那么会导致WebDriverException。请确保您的元素定位器是正确的,或者重新检查页面结构。
3. 检查网络连接:如果您的测试代码需要连接到互联网或本地服务器,则网络连接可能会导致WebDriverException。请确保您的网络连接正常。
4. 重新启动浏览器:有时候浏览器可能会出现问题,导致WebDriverException。尝试重新启动浏览器,看看是否可以解决问题。
5. 更换WebDriver驱动程序:如果您使用的WebDriver驱动程序已经过时或者存在已知问题,那么可能会导致WebDriverException。尝试更新或更换WebDriver驱动程序。
总之,解决WebDriverException的方法取决于具体的异常情况,需要针对性地进行解决。
相关问题
WebDriverException
WebDriverException是一个通用的异常类,用于表示在使用WebDriver时发生的各种异常情况。它可以被抛出来,以告知用户发生了异常情况,比如无法连接到浏览器,或者无法找到指定的元素等等。通常情况下,这个异常类都会包含一些详细的错误信息,以便用户可以更好地了解问题的具体原因,并尝试解决它。
webdriverexception
WebDriverException 是一个通用的异常类型,它表示在使用 Selenium WebDriver 时发生了错误。它可能由于多种原因而引发,如浏览器配置错误、网络问题等。为了更好地调试和解决问题,应该检查堆栈跟踪并尝试重现错误。